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 58012 zip code. The total population is 2750, of which, 1494 are male and 1256 are female. With a total area of 174.444 square miles, the population density is 17.1 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 33 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 58012 zip code is $109808. This is -12.77% less than the national average. This income places 2.6%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$18325. Education

In the 58012 zip code, 95.1%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 36.9%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 58012 zip, there are an estimated 1605 people in the labor force, of which, 1576 are employed, and 20 are unemployed. There are a total of 9 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 30.1 minutes. Of the total people that work, 83 worked from home and 1572 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 42.4. Housing

The median home value for the 58012 zip code is 238900. There is an estimated  1162 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$707 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$749.
